All rights reserved. + * Use is subject to license terms. + */ + +#pragma ident "@(#)coshl.c 1.7 06/01/31 SMI" + +#if defined(ELFOBJ) +#pragma weak coshl = __coshl +#endif + +#include "libm.h" + +/* + * COSH(X) + * RETURN THE HYPERBOLIC COSINE OF X + * + * Method : + * 1. Replace x by |x| (COSH(x) = COSH(-x)). + * 2. + * [ EXP(x) - 1 ]^2 + * 0 <= x <= 0.3465 : COSH(x) := 1 + ------------------- + * 2*EXP(x) + * + * EXP(x) + 1/EXP(x) + * 0.3465 <= x <= thresh : COSH(x) := ------------------- + * 2 + * thresh <= x <= lnovft : COSH(x) := EXP(x)/2 + * lnovft <= x < INF : COSH(x) := SCALBN(EXP(x-MEP1*ln2),ME) + * + * + * here + * 0.3465 a number that is near one half of ln2. + * thresh a number such that + * EXP(thresh)+EXP(-thresh)=EXP(thresh) + * lnovft logarithm of the overflow threshold + * = MEP1*ln2 chopped to machine precision. + * ME maximum exponent + * MEP1 maximum exponent plus 1 + * + * Special cases: + * COSH(x) is |x| if x is +INF, -INF, or NaN. + * only COSH(0)=1 is exact for finite x. + */ + +static const long double C[] = { + 0.5L, + 1.0L, + 0.3465L, + 45.0L, + 1.135652340629414394879149e+04L, + 7.004447686242549087858985e-16L, + 2.710505431213761085018632e-20L, /* 2^-65 */ +}; + +#define half C[0] +#define one C[1] +#define thr1 C[2] +#define thr2 C[3] +#define lnovft C[4] +#define lnovlo C[5] +#define tinyl C[6] + +long double +coshl(long double x) { + long double w, t; + + w = fabsl(x); + if (!finitel(w)) + return (w + w); /* x is INF or NaN */ + if (w < thr1) { + if (w < tinyl) + return (one + w); /* inexact+directed rounding */ + t = expm1l(w); + w = one + t; + w = one + (t * t) / (w + w); + return (w); + } + if (w < thr2) { + t = expl(w); + return (half * (t + one / t)); + } + if (w <= lnovft) + return (half * expl(w)); + return (scalbnl(expl((w - lnovft) - lnovlo), 16383)); +} |
